Block
#13,418,179
5w
3 txs168,615 confs
Transactions
3
Total Output
₳1,837,005.26
$279.19K
Fees
₳1.6
Size
4.73 KB
4,848 bytes
Details
Hash
ba853b524ee5e1b5af83a26590aed78ac565d8dfd616c4e64b19172a1eb0dc08
Epoch / Slot
Epoch 630 · slot 187,214,589 · epoch-slot 417,789
Timestamp
5w · Thu, 14 May 2026 17:48:00 GMT
Block producer
VRF key
vrf_vk1s…rs87lqz0
Op cert
c34a6f06…57972681
Op cert counter
2
Transactions in block3